#18f058 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18f058 is composed of 9.4% red, 94.1%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.3%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 137.8 degrees, a saturation of 87.8% and a lightness of 51.8%. #18f058 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ffb0 with #00e100.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

#18f058 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#18f058 has RGB values of R:24, G:240,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 1634392.
